UNESCO World Heritage Site Hallstatt-Dachstein/Salzkammergut

Learn more about the special features of this unique UNESCO World Heritage Site in a guided cultural tour. Hallstatt is one of only 20 World Heritage Sites in the world that have received the title of natural and cultural heritage at the same time.

Geography

Hallstatt is located in the inner Salzkammergut on the western shore of Lake Hallstatt. On the narrow strip of shore between the lake and the steep mountain slope, the houses are crowded close together and some are even built with piles into the lake.

History

Until the end of the 19th century, Hallstatt could only be reached by boat (from Obertraun or Untersee) or on foot along narrow mule tracks.

In the village itself, the small space between the mountain and the lake had been used to the last. There were only connections between the houses standing on the lake by boat or via the "upper way", a narrow passage over attics.
